Diketimines can be prepared by condensation of 1,2-diketones with 2 equiv of an amine, or 1 equiv of a 1,2-diamine, by azeotropic removal of water. Either a chiral diketone or a chiral amine/diamine can be used in order to obtain a chiral diimine. In both cases, the use of 1,2-diamines is expected to provide better stereocontrol, because of the rigidity of the derived cyclic diimines. For example, the reaction of camphor 1,2-diketone 275 and racemic 1,2-diphenylethylenediamine (d,l)-26 gave the diimine 276 as a mixture of two diastereomers (Scheme 45) [138]. Reduction of 276 with sodium borohydride followed by hydrogenolysis of the N substituents afforded the camphordiamine, which was isolated as the dihydrochloride... [Pg.52]

In contrast to 53, reduction of 3,5- Pr2-Ar FeCl 2 in the presence of benzene afforded the orange half-sandwich complex 54. The iron is coordinated to the ipso carbon of the terphenyl ligand and a benzene in an ti fashion. The C( 1 )-Fe-centroid is strictly linear and the Fe(l)-centroid distance of 1.6427(13)A is similar to the Fe-centroid distance of 1.6245(8) A in the related P-diketiminate Fe(I) complex [ (C6H3-2,6-Pr2)NC(Me) 2CH]Fe(Ti -C6H6) [94], but is shorter than the 1.733(2) and 1.763(2) A in Ar FeFeAr (42). Magnetic studies showed that the Fe(I) center adopts a high-spin configuration with three unpaired electrons. [Pg.95]
